made by Toonhawk for LD35 (JAM)
A simple action puzzle game based on the idea of shifting shapes around, like tetris meets hole in the wall.

The game is played using the arrow keys, up and down to shift shape and left and right to rotate. The game has 20 obstacles in a randomized order to get through. It's mainly a proof of concept so graphics and UI are barebones and audio nonexistant.
